The Allianz Group Information Security function ensures that information security and cyber risks that may impact the successful delivery of Allianz business objectives are identified and properly addressed. It encompasses the Allianz Information Security strategy, the Allianz Global IT Security Program, and a strong Information Security Risk Management culture. The main objectives are:
- Develop an Information Security Risk Management culture within Allianz by maintaining a strong framework and business visibility.
- Build a strong Information Security Community within Allianz and with key external partners.
- Maintain practical policies and standards across the Allianz Group.
- Govern key global security initiatives and solutions that strengthen cyber resilience, ensure regulatory compliance, and minimise risks of data loss.
- Ensure excellent awareness in the area of Information Security and Risk for all Allianz employees.
How can you make an impact?
You will establish oversight and drive Information and Cyber Risk Management for global Security Platforms and Security in global Shared Service Platforms. Key duties include:
- Manage and develop the governance of Security Platforms and Security of defined Group Core Platforms (e.g. Cloud, Identity and Access Management, Privileged Access, Network, Public Key Infrastructure, Endpoint, ..) within their lifecycle.
- Ensure proper positioning of Information Security Risk assessments in key processes and services.
- Control and review implementation and trigger improvements of the security of Platforms from a technological, procedural and Service Management perspective.
- Review security controls in OEs and 3rd parties for platform services.
- Based on review results trigger the documentation and tracking of findings in the central risk register and related processes.
- Contribute to a Global Information Security Risk Scorecard and provide input to various Risk Committees and governance bodies.
